3D printing filament Spectrum 5903175657619 — ABS / PETG, White, 1.75 mm, 1.4 kg
Spectrum 5903175657619 is a white 3D printing filament composed of ABS and PETG polymers, supplied on a 1.4 kg spool with a 1.75 mm diameter. Designed for FDM/FFF desktop printers and compatible with any brand, this filament targets users who need rigid, chemically resistant parts as well as visual models. The material formulation balances the rigidity and impact resistance of ABS with the low-shrinkage and layer cohesion advantages of PETG, producing parts suitable for prototyping, functional components and semi-transparent elements when printed with minimal outer perimeters.
The combined ABS/PETG composition delivers good mechanical strength, dimensional accuracy and improved inter-layer adhesion compared with many single-polymer filaments. PETG’s low moisture absorption and very low shrinkage reduce warping and help maintain consistent part geometry. The material exhibits chemical resistance and good creep resistance under sustained load, while printing is odour-reduced. Spools are vacuum-packed with a desiccant and labelled with material type, diameter and suggested printing temperatures to preserve filament quality.
Load the 1.75 mm filament onto any compatible FDM/FFF desktop printer following the printer manufacturer’s instructions. Use temperature and print settings appropriate for ABS/PETG blends; consult the spool label or printer material database for recommended nozzle and bed temperatures, print speed and cooling. Ensure the filament is dry before printing—keep the spool sealed until use or dry in a filament dryer if necessary. Print first-layer settings and bed adhesion methods (heated bed, adhesive or build surface) should be adjusted to minimise warping and achieve optimal dimensional accuracy.
For best results, store unopened spools in their vacuum packaging with the desiccant. When printing semi-transparent parts, reduce the number of outer perimeters and optimise extrusion settings to accentuate the near-transparency effect. Use a heated bed and moderate enclosure temperatures for better dimensional stability when printing larger or more rigid parts. Avoid prolonged exposure to moisture during storage and handle printed parts with appropriate safety measures when they will contact food or chemicals; verify food-contact suitability based on end-use requirements.
